The song talks about how people in this world are looking for somebody to be an "angel". Now, an angel, in simple terms, is a messenger from God. As Christians, I think that it is our job to be the angel to these people. One way we can be an angel to the hurting, is through service. Jesus give us a great example of service in the parable of the Good Samaritan:
"Jesus replied and said, "A man was going down from Jerusalem to Jericho, and fell among robbers, and they stripped him and beat him, and went away leaving him half dead. And by chance a priest was going down on that road, and when he saw him, he passed by on the other side. Likewise a Levite also, when he came to the place and saw him, passed by on the other side. But a Samaritan, who was on a journey, came upon him; and when he saw him, he felt compassion, and came to him and bandaged up his wounds, pouting oil and wine on them; and he put him on his own beast, and brought him to an inn and took care of him. On the next day he took out two denarii and gave them to the innkeeper and said, 'Take care of him; and whatever more you spend when I return I will repay you."
-Luke 10:30-35
This story is a beautiful example of service. The Samaritan saw this guy on the side of the rode, sacrificed his time, energy, and money to make sure that this man got better. He was being an angel to this man.
